Ingredients

The following ingredients have 4 Servings
  • 2 tbsp extra virgin olive oil
  • 1 cup red onions (diced)
  • 3 garlic cloves (minced)
  • 1 ½ cup sweet potato (diced)
  • 1 cup turnip (diced)
  • 1 ½ zucchini (diced)
  • 2 cups diced tomatoes can with the juice
  • 1 cup homemade tomato sauce (whole30 friendly)
  • 3 eggs
  • Pinch of chili pepper
  • Salt and pepper
  • Green onions for garnishing

Instruction

  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ees F.
  • In a large pan, add olive oil over medium-high heat.
  • Add onions and garlic. Cook until the onions are brown. Stir frequently.
  • Add sweet potato and turnip. Cook for about 5 minutes.
  • Add zucchini, diced tomato, and tomato sauce.
  • Cook until veggies are tender. If necessary, add water to help to cook the veggies.
  • Spread vegetable mixture evenly in the greased baking dish (casserole dish).
  • With the back of a large spoon, make three indentations in the veggies mixture.
  • Crack 1 large egg into each indentation, keeping the yolk intact.
  • Season eggs with salt and pepper.
  • Bake for about 15-20 minutes or until the eggs whites are set.
  • Remove from oven and garnish with green onions
